Everlast also known as Whitney Ford and Erik Schrody is singer, songwriter and rapper on 'Eat at Whitney's'. His last single 'What it's like' was Grammy nominated and a chart hit. This album draws from blues, rock, folk and classical as well as it does from his hip-hop roots. Everlast have even used Carlos Santana on the track 'Babylon Feeling' which is a fairly heavy rock track with great guitar licks. 'We're all gonna die' has a nice melody and features the high-pitched backing vocals of Cee-Lo. Out of the 13 tracks only 3 of them are what you would call rap tracks. The rest feature Everlast strumming and picking away at his guitar, spinning his tales of life. There's a rugged edge and flair with the and if you are someone who appreciates hip hop then this is certainly an album to purchse. Summary: |
